so thats the complete code. Now I get an error on line 5
“Assets/Weapons/Scripts/Gun.cs(5,7): error CS0101: The namespace global::' already contains a definition for Gun’”

I hope u can help me.

BTW: Sorry for my english :wink:

You have two classes named Gun.

but where?! :open_mouth:

Check your project and see if you have two scripts named Gun or you have a sub class in your namespace with Gun as the name.

1 Like

Ok I got the error, it was really a different script.
